Dark Chocolate and Raspberries: A Sophisticated Thanksgiving Dessert Match

Dark chocolate and raspberries are a timeless combination known for their contrasting flavors. The bold, slightly bitter taste pairs beautifully with fresh raspberry Zries’ tangy, juicy burst. This pairing is ideal for Thanksgiving desserts that balance richness and freshness, making it perfect for chocolate tarts or dipped raspberry platters. Furthermore, dark chocolate's depth enhances the sweetness of the berries, creating a balanced and sophisticated dessert.

Milk Chocolate and Strawberries: A Classic Thanksgiving Dessert Pairing

Milk chocolate and strawberries are classics that appeal to all ages, making them perfect choices for family gatherings. The creamy sweetness of milk chocolate complements the slightly tart, juicy strawberries, creating a smooth and delicious flavor profile for your Thanksgiving dessert. This pairing is also excellent for desserts like chocolate-dipped strawberries, where the contrast in texture and taste is highlighted. Adding a bit of sea salt or crushed nuts enhances the richness of the milk chocolate, making it even more delightful.

Consider serving a chocolate strawberry fondue or a layered dessert featuring milk chocolate mousse with fresh strawberry slices for Thanksgiving. These options allow guests to enjoy the combination at their own pace while making it a fun, interactive dessert.

White Chocolate and Blueberries: A Creamy Thanksgiving Dessert Contrast

White chocolate and blueberries make an elegant and unique pairing that brings a touch of sophistication to Thanksgiving dessert tables. White chocolate’s mild, creamy taste complements the sweet and slightly tart blueberries, creating a balanced dessert option. This pairing works wonderfully in desserts like cheesecakes, parfaits, white chocolate, and blueberry bark. The colors are also visually stunning, adding a festive and elegant touch to your Thanksgiving spread.

Consider serving a white chocolate blueberry cheesecake or small white chocolate cups filled with blueberry compote for individual servings. Adding a hint of lemon zest further enhances the flavor, bringing out the brightness of the blueberries against the rich white chocolate. Dark Chocolate and Orange: A Bold and Citrusy Harmony

The combination of dark chocolate and orange is an intense and aromatic pairing that brings warmth and depth to Thanksgiving desserts. Dark chocolate's rich, slightly bitter flavor is enhanced by orange's bright, tangy citrus notes.

This pairing is great for desserts like chocolate orange tarts, dark chocolate, orange bark, or orange-infused dark chocolate mousse. The hint of citrus also cuts through the richness, making this combination perfect for those who enjoy refined desserts.

A dark chocolate orange tart with a hint of sea salt or an orange-scented chocolate ganache offers a bold dessert finish to any Thanksgiving meal. Orange zest or a light sprinkle of cinnamon adds warmth, enhancing the chocolate and the orange flavor. Milk Chocolate and Bananas: A Desserts and Creamy Pairing

Milk chocolate and bananas are a comforting, nostalgic pairing that’s loved by many. The creamy, mellow flavor of milk chocolate complements the soft sweetness of bananas, making this combination a classic choice for dessert. This pairing is perfect for Thanksgiving desserts like chocolate-covered banana bites, chocolate banana cream pie, or banana and chocolate layer cake. The softness of the banana works beautifully with the smoothness of milk chocolate, creating a comforting and satisfying dessert.

Consider serving banana and chocolate mousse cups or a layered banana chocolate parfait for an easy, crowd-pleasing option. The mild flavors allow for added elements like whipped cream or chopped nuts, enhancing the dessert further.
